|
@@ -557,11 +557,11 @@ public class EmployeeServiceImpl extends BaseServiceImpl<Integer, Employee> impl
|
|
|
|
|
|
try {
|
|
|
|
|
|
- List<Integer> collect1 = entry.getValue().stream()
|
|
|
- .map(x -> x.getUserId().intValue()).distinct().collect(Collectors.toList());
|
|
|
-
|
|
|
- Map<Integer, String> avatarMap = teacherDao.getUsersSimpleInfo(collect1).stream()
|
|
|
- .collect(Collectors.toMap(SimpleUserDto::getUserId, SimpleUserDto::getAvatar, (o, n) -> n));
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
|
|
|
|
|
|
for (ImGroupMemberWrapper.ImGroupMember member : entry.getValue()) {
|
|
@@ -624,16 +624,16 @@ public class EmployeeServiceImpl extends BaseServiceImpl<Integer, Employee> impl
|
|
|
|
|
|
try {
|
|
|
|
|
|
- List<Integer> collect1 = entry.getValue().stream()
|
|
|
- .map(x -> x.getUserId().intValue()).distinct().collect(Collectors.toList());
|
|
|
-
|
|
|
- Map<Integer, String> avatarMap = teacherDao.getUsersSimpleInfo(collect1).stream()
|
|
|
- .collect(Collectors.toMap(SimpleUserDto::getUserId, SimpleUserDto::getAvatar, (o, n) -> n));
|
|
|
-
|
|
|
-
|
|
|
- for (GroupMemberWrapper.ImGroupMember member : entry.getValue()) {
|
|
|
- member.setAvatar(avatarMap.getOrDefault(member.getUserId().intValue(), ""));
|
|
|
- }
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
+
|
|
|
|
|
|
imGroupCoreService.groupQuit(entry.getValue(), entry.getKey());
|
|
|
} catch (Exception e) {
|